Evelyn Irene Johnston, 90, of Festus died April 5, 2024, at her home. Mrs. Johnston worked for the Windsor School District. She loved to bowl and enjoyed reading, fishing and spending time with her grandchildren. Born Sept. 26, 1933, in St. Louis, she was the daughter of the late Irene (Moss) Mc Dow and Robert Byrne.
She was preceded in death by her husband: Arch Johnston.
She is survived by three daughters: Debbie Whitener of Festus, DJ (Kathy) Johnston of Festus and Cindy (Lee) Webb of Festus; eight grandchildren: Aubree (Mike) Birkenmier, William Oster, Mitchell (Amber) Mouser, Mickel (Ryan) Wass, Destin Mouser, Laney (Dylan) Webb, Leah (Zach) Webb and Levi (amber) Webb; and 12 great-grandchildren: Madeline Birkenmier, Avery Birkenmier, Lanny Birkenmier, Max Birkenmier, Jacob Oster, Sophia Oster, Brady Sadler, Knox Mouser, Lance Mouser, Jack Wass, Hadden Wass and Valerie Peters.
She also was preceded in death by a daughter: Linda (Glen survives of Festus) Mouser.
